Division I LEARFIELD Standings - Final Winter

Overall Standings ... Conference Standings

CLEVELAND
– The Buckeyes of Ohio State have almost a 110-point lead heading into the spring LEARFIELD Directors' Cup standings. Ohio State has tallied 1017.25 total points, finishing fifth in men's ice hockey, seventh in men's gymnastics and ninth in women's gymnastics.
 
The Stanford Cardinal are in second with 908.00 total points. In the most recent championships, the Stanford men's gymnastics team took home the title, while the women's gymnastics team finished 17th overall.
 
Rounding out the top-five is Penn State in third with 802.00 points, Texas in fourth with 758.75 points and Michigan in fifth with 737.25 points.
 
The Nittany Lions finished fifth overall in men's gymnastics and 17th on the women's side, while also finishing fifth in men's ice hockey to break into the top-five in the final winter standings.
 
Two-time winner, Texas scored in six winter championships, with five top-10 finishes, including a runner-up finish in women's indoor track and field.
 
Michigan broke into the top-five in the final winter standings after hovering close at the end of the fall season and the first set of winter scoring. The Wolverines have scored in eight winter championships, including finishing second overall in the most recent men's gymnastics championship and tied for third in men's ice hockey.
 
CONFERENCE
At the conference level, the SEC leads all Division I conferences with seven institutions in the top-25 – Alabama (7th), Arkansas (9th), Tennessee (11th), Georgia (13th), LSU (15th), Kentucky (16th), and Florida (25th).

The LEARFIELD Directors' Cup was developed as a joint effort between the National Association of Collegiate Directors of Athletics (NACDA) and USA Today. Points are awarded based on each institution's finish in NCAA Championships.
